Name Net reduced
positions
Reduced positions Increased positions Return since
31 Dec ‘19
2126
1 6 5 71.5%
2127
1 6 5 107%
2128
1 3 2 199%
TTI icon
2129
TETRA Technologies
TTI
$1.39B
1 43 42 430%
2130
1 4 3 88.6%
2131
1 234 233 0.19%
2132
1 9 8 57.3%
2133
1 3 2 10.9%
2134
1 8 7 120%
2135
1 2 1 29.5%
VVPR icon
2136
VivoPower
VVPR
$44.5M
1 2 1 74.8%
2137
1 3 2 138%
2138
1 103 102 37.2%
2139
1 8 7 102%
2140
1 3 2 69.6%
2141
1 28 27 253%
2142
1 11 10 90.9%
2143
1 2 1 100%
2144
1 2 1 81.3%
2145
1 1 0
2146
1 3 2 83.5%
2147
1 5 4 57.8%
2148
1 3 2 3.62%
2149
1 1 0
2150
1 4 3 69.3%